The Pearson Edexcel Functional Skills Qualifications in Mathematics at Level 1 and Level 2 are for learners who want to develop understanding and skills in mathematics.
The qualifications give learners the opportunity to:
● demonstrate a sound grasp of the underpinning skills and basics of mathematical skills appropriate to the level, and apply mathematical thinking to solve simple problems in familiar situations.
Learning outcomes
Functional Skills mathematics qualifications at these levels should:
● indicate that students can demonstrate their ability in mathematical skills and their ability to apply these, through appropriate reasoning and decision making, to solve realistic problems of increasing complexity;
● introduce students to new areas of life and work so that they are exposed to concepts and problems which, while not of immediate concern, may be of value in later life; and
● enable students to develop an appreciation of the role played by mathematics in the world of work and in life generally.
